To strengthen tuberculosis elimination, the Ministry of Health provides additional assistance to patients
The Ministry of Health of the Republic of Indonesia is fully covering the costs of tuberculosis treatment, both drug-sensitive and drug-resistant TB, as part of the government’s ‘quick win’ programme to accelerate the elimination of cases in a massive and measurable way. Deputy Minister of Health, Benjamin Paulus Octavianus, stated on Thursday (25/2) that the government is also providing cash assistance and food support to vulnerable patients in the lowest income brackets to support treatment adherence.
